等离子清洗处理SERS活性金岛膜表面杂质的研究
A Research on Plasma Cleaning for Removing Contaminants from SERS-active Gold Island Films Surfaces
【摘要】 采用真空蒸镀法在硅片表面形成了一层具有表面增强拉曼活性的金岛膜。拉曼光谱发现该金岛膜表面存在非晶态碳的污染物。通过比较不同清洗方法的拉曼光谱可以证明,用氧气等离子体清洗金岛膜可有效去除金表面的杂质。金岛膜的表面增强拉曼活性在清洗前后没有发生明显变化。
【Abstract】 Gold island films were prepared by vacuum deposition of gold wire on to silicon substrate.Raman spectra analysis indicated that the resulting gold island films surfaces were polluted by amorphous carbon.Oxygen plasma cleaning was used to remove surface contaminants.A comparison between the Raman spectra of different cleaning methods proved that oxygen plasma cleaning removed the amorphous carbon from gold surfaces effectively.The plasma-treated sample surfaces didn’t show significant change in SERS enhancement.
